亲爱的用户:
比特国际交易平台(GJ.COM)已于2019年2月3日正式上线ARDR,开放充值、提现服务,并同步开启交易功能。
Cardano建设者IOG资助斯坦福大学区块链研究中心 450 万美元:金色财经报道,Cardano 区块链建设者 Input Output Global (IOG) 已在斯坦福大学资助了一个价值 450 万美元的区块链中心。
除了斯坦福,IOG 还与爱丁堡大学、怀俄明大学、雅典大学和东京工业大学开设了研究实验室和合作项目。去年,卡尔达诺创始人查尔斯霍斯金森向卡内基梅隆大学(CMU) 捐赠了 2000 万美元,用于建立霍斯金森形式数学中心。(coindesk)[2022/8/30 12:56:31]
已开放ARDR交易对为:ARDR/BTC
慢雾:Cover协议被黑问题出在rewardWriteoff具体计算参数变化导致差值:2020年12月29日,慢雾安全团队对整个Cover协议被攻击流程进行了简要分析。
1.在Cover协议的Blacksmith合约中,用户可以通过deposit函数抵押BPT代币;
2.攻击者在第一次进行deposit-withdraw后将通过updatePool函数来更新池子,并使用accRewardsPerToken来记录累计奖励;
3.之后将通过_claimCoverRewards函数来分配奖励并使用rewardWriteoff参数进行记录;
4.在攻击者第一次withdraw后还留有一小部分的BPT进行抵押;
5.此时攻击者将第二次进行deposit,并通过claimRewards提取奖励;
6.问题出在rewardWriteoff的具体计算,在攻击者第二次进行deposit-claimRewards时取的Pool值定义为memory,此时memory中获取的Pool是攻击者第一次withdraw进行updatePool时更新的值;
7.由于memory中获取的Pool值是旧的,其对应记录的accRewardsPerToken也是旧的会赋值到miner;
8.之后再进行新的一次updatePool时,由于攻击者在第一次进行withdraw后池子中的lpTotal已经变小,所以最后获得的accRewardsPerToken将变大;
9.此时攻击者被赋值的accRewardsPerToken是旧的是一个较小值,在进行rewardWriteoff计算时获得的值也将偏小,但攻击者在进行claimRewards时用的却是池子更新后的accRewardsPerToken值;
10.因此在进行具体奖励计算时由于这个新旧参数之前差值,会导致计算出一个偏大的数值;
11.所以最后在根据计算结果给攻击者铸造奖励时就会额外铸造出更多的COVER代币,导致COVER代币增发。具体accRewardsPerToken参数差值变化如图所示。[2020/12/29 15:58:07]
ARDR由阿朵主链产生,是一个运行所有子链和所有交易的服务系统。一些交易将在主链运行,如交易ARDR,然而为了提高主链性能和减少区块臃肿,但很多特性是在主链不可用的。ARDR主链采用100%的POS机制,不需要矿工也没有新币被创建。?
Cardano Node或于下周发布1.19版本:Cardano创始人Charles Hoskinson刚刚发推文称,Cardano Node即将发布的版本要快得多。将看看下周是否可以发布1.19版本,将包含smash功能、钱包后端和Shelley钱包daedalus改进。[2020/8/15]
相关链接:
网站:https://ardorplatform.org
twitter:https://twitter.com/ardorplatform?lang=en
GJteam
2019.2.3
?
郑重声明: 本文版权归原作者所有, 转载文章仅为传播更多信息之目的, 如作者信息标记有误, 请第一时间联系我们修改或删除, 多谢。